About Kibaek Lee

Kibaek Lee is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Pollution, having authored 58 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Membrane Separation Technologies (32 papers),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(23 papers) and Water Treatment and Disinfection (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(1.3k citations), Pollution (339 citations) and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(318 citations). Kibaek Lee has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Kwang‐Ho Choo, Chung‐Hak Lee, Jaewoo Lee, In‐Chul Kim, Hong H. Lee, Jong‐Min Lee, Pyung‐Kyu Park, Huarong Yu, Xiaolei Zhang and Chang Hyun Nahm.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Chemical Physics, Environmental Science & Technology and Journal of Applied Physics.
